Crankshaft Rear Seal with Retainer Plate: Installation

  1. NOTE: If the rear crankshaft seal retaining plate is not secured within 5 minutes, the sealant must be removed and the sealing area cleaned. Failure to follow this procedure may cause future oil leaks.

    Apply a 3.75 mm (0.147 in) bead of silicone gasket and sealant to the chamfer of the rear crankshaft seal retaining plate sealing surface.

    Material: Motorcraft® Silicone Gasket and Sealant / TA-30 (WSE-M4G323-A4)

  2. NOTE: If the rear crankshaft seal retaining plate is not secured within 5 minutes, the sealant must be removed and the sealing area cleaned. Failure to follow this procedure may cause future oil leaks.

    Apply 12 mm (0.47 in) drops of silicone gasket and sealant to the crankshaft rear seal retainer plate-to-cylinder block sealing surfaces.

    Material: Motorcraft® Silicone Gasket and Sealant / TA-30 (WSE-M4G323-A4)

  3. Tilt the seal retainer up and onto the rear of the cylinder block.

  4. Install the bolts and tighten in sequence.

    Torque: Stage 1: 89 lb.in (10 Nm) | Stage 2: 45°

    Fig 1: Crankshaft Rear Seal Retainer Plate Tightening Sequence

  5. Install the oil pan-to-rear main seal retainer plate bolts.

    Torque: Stage 1: 89 lb.in (10 Nm) | Stage 2: 45°

  6. Lubricate the seal bore and the seal lips with clean engine oil.

    • Position the special tool onto the end of the crankshaft. Use Special Service Tool: 303-1250 Seal Installer, Rear Main.

    • Slide the new crankshaft rear seal onto the tool.

  7. Tool PENDING Using the special tools, install the crankshaft rear seal. Use Special Service Tool: 205-153 (T80T-4000-W) Handle., 303-1250 Seal Installer, Rear Main.

    1. Install the CKP sensor and the bolt.

      Torque: 89 lb.in (10 Nm)

    2. Connect the CKP sensor electrical connector.
    3. Reposition the insulator.

  8. Install the crankshaft sensor ring and the engine-to-transmission spacer plate.
